Match Overview

The match started with an early flourish, as Manchester City took the lead in the seventh minute. Bernardo Silva capitalized on a particular cutback from Omar Marmoush, regardless of Villa goalkeeper Emiliano Martínez’s try and intervention. 

However, Villa replied swiftly, with Marcus Rashford converting a penalty in the 18th minute after a VAR evaluator decided that Ruben Dias had fouled Jacob Ramsey in the box. The first 1/2 of concluded with each groups stage at 1-1.​

The 2d 1/2 of them noticed each aspect’s developing opportunities, however it wasn’t till the 94th minute that the decisive second arrived. Jeremy Doku brought a low go into the box, which Matheus Nunes latched onto, scoring his first Premier League goal to steady all 3 points for City.​

Key Performers

Matheus Nunes (Manchester City): Scored the match-triumphing goal in stoppage time, marking his first Premier League goal for City.​

Jeremy Doku (Manchester City): Provided the critical help for Nunes’ goal, showcasing his tempo and vision.​

Marcus Rashford (Aston Villa): Converted the penalty to equalize for Villa, demonstrating composure under pressure.​
